nx_cms_lms_gate.nx -- CMS LMS/MEMBERSHIP gate: land the missing LearnDash/MemberPress class HONESTLY by
proving the sovereign sequential-progress engine over a 3-lesson course -- enrollment gates access,
lessons drip in order, skip-ahead is refused, progress can't double-count, course completion + cert
eligibility require enrollment AND full completion. Positive AND negative controls throughout. Appends
"CMSGATE row=nx_cms_lms lms-membership ... verdict=PASS" to knowledge/status/cms_gate.log ONLY if every
assertion holds. Exit 0 iff all pass. license_tier: ORIGINAL
